The agrochemical market is a critical segment within the global agriculture industry, encompassing a wide range of chemical products utilized to enhance crop yield and protect plants from pests, diseases, and weeds. This market is fundamentally driven by the necessity to meet the escalating food demand from a growing global population, coupled with the increasing need to improve agricultural productivity on limited arable land. Agrochemicals, which include fertilizers, pesticides, herbicides, and insecticides, play an indispensable role in modern farming practices by ensuring crop health and maximizing output. The industry is characterized by continuous research and development efforts aimed at introducing more effective and environmentally sustainable solutions. Geographically, the market demonstrates a significant presence in both developed and emerging economies, with variations in adoption rates influenced by regulatory frameworks, agricultural practices, and economic conditions. Leading companies are actively engaged in innovating products that address specific regional challenges while adhering to stringent environmental and safety standards. The market's evolution is also shaped by technological advancements, such as the integration of digital farming tools and precision agriculture techniques, which optimize the application and efficiency of agrochemical inputs. Overall, the agrochemical market remains a cornerstone of agricultural productivity, supporting global food security objectives and economic development in rural communities worldwide.

The agrochemical market is propelled by several powerful drivers, with the foremost being the increasing global population and the consequent rise in food demand, which necessitates higher agricultural productivity. This is further amplified by the shrinking availability of arable land, compelling farmers to adopt intensive farming practices that rely heavily on agrochemical inputs to maximize yields. Technological advancements in formulation chemistry and application methods also serve as significant drivers, enhancing the efficiency and effectiveness of these products. Opportunities within the market are abundant, particularly in the realm of sustainable agriculture. There is a growing opportunity for the development and commercialization of bio-agrochemicals, which are derived from natural sources and offer an eco-friendly alternative to synthetic chemicals. The expansion of precision farming technologies presents another lucrative opportunity, allowing for targeted and reduced use of agrochemicals, thereby lowering costs and environmental impact. Emerging economies, with their large agricultural sectors and increasing adoption of modern farming techniques, represent key growth markets for agrochemical companies. However, the market faces notable restraints, including stringent regulatory requirements and increasing public scrutiny regarding the environmental and health impacts of chemical usage. Resistance development in pests and weeds to existing products poses a continuous challenge, necessitating ongoing investment in research. Additionally, the high cost of developing and registering new agrochemicals can act as a barrier to entry for smaller players and slow down innovation.
The global agrochemical market exhibits a high level of concentration, with a few multinational corporations dominating the industry landscape. This concentrated structure is a result of significant consolidation through mergers and acquisitions, which have created entities with extensive product portfolios, robust research and development capabilities, and widespread global distribution networks. Leading companies such as Bayer AG, Syngenta Group, BASF SE, Corteva Agriscience, and FMC Corporation collectively command a substantial market share. These industry giants invest heavily in innovation to develop new active ingredients and formulations, often focusing on integrated solutions that address multiple crop protection needs. Their dominance is reinforced by strong brand recognition, established relationships with farmers and distributors, and the financial resources required to navigate complex regulatory environments across different countries. Despite this high concentration, the market also includes a number of mid-sized and smaller companies that often specialize in niche segments, such as bio-pesticides or specific regional markets. These smaller players compete by offering specialized products or leveraging local expertise. The competitive dynamics are characterized by intense research rivalry, patent expirations, and the continuous need to adapt to evolving agricultural practices and sustainability demands. This concentration trend is expected to persist, driven by the high costs associated with product development and the strategic benefits of scale in a globally competitive market.
The agrochemical market is segmented into various types based on the chemical composition and primary function of the products. The major categories include fertilizers, pesticides, herbicides, and insecticides, each serving a distinct purpose in agricultural production. Fertilizers constitute a fundamental segment, providing essential nutrients like nitrogen, phosphorus, and potassium to soil to promote plant growth and improve crop yields. They are further classified into organic and inorganic types, with inorganic fertilizers being more widely used due to their immediate nutrient availability. Pesticides represent a broad category designed to control, repel, or eradicate pests that threaten crops. This includes insecticides targeting insect populations, herbicides for weed management, and fungicides to prevent fungal diseases. Herbicides hold a significant share within the pesticide segment, driven by the critical need for effective weed control to prevent yield losses. Insecticides are crucial for protecting crops from damaging insect infestations. Additionally, there is a growing segment of bio-based agrochemicals, which are derived from natural materials such as plants, bacteria, and minerals. These products are gaining popularity as sustainable alternatives to synthetic chemicals, aligning with the increasing consumer and regulatory demand for environmentally friendly farming practices. The development of combination products that offer multiple functions, such as fertilizer-pesticide mixes, is also a notable trend, providing convenience and efficiency for farmers.
Agrochemicals find application across a diverse range of crop types and farming systems, playing a vital role in ensuring food security and agricultural sustainability. The primary application segments include cereal & grains, oilseeds & pulses, fruits & vegetables, and other commercial crops. Cereal and grain crops, such as wheat, rice, and corn, represent the largest application area due to their status as staple food sources globally and their extensive cultivation. The use of fertilizers and protective chemicals is intensive in these crops to achieve high yields. Oilseeds and pulses, including soybean, canola, and lentils, also constitute a major application segment, driven by the demand for vegetable oils and protein-rich foods. The fruits and vegetables segment is characterized by high-value produce that often requires precise and sometimes more frequent agrochemical applications to maintain quality, appearance, and shelf life, given their susceptibility to pests and diseases. Furthermore, agrochemicals are extensively used in the cultivation of commercial crops like cotton, sugarcane, and coffee, where maximizing productivity is directly linked to economic returns. Beyond traditional field crops, applications are expanding into horticulture, floriculture, and even non-agricultural areas like turf management and forestry. The adoption patterns vary significantly by region, influenced by local crop patterns, climatic conditions, technological adoption rates, and regulatory frameworks governing chemical use.
The agrochemical market demonstrates distinct regional dynamics influenced by agricultural practices, economic development, regulatory policies, and climatic conditions. The Asia-Pacific region stands as the largest and fastest-growing market, propelled by countries with vast agricultural sectors such as China and India. High population density, increasing food demand, and government initiatives to enhance farm productivity are key growth drivers in this region. North America and Europe represent mature markets characterized by high adoption rates of advanced agricultural technologies and stringent regulatory standards for agrochemical usage. In these regions, there is a strong emphasis on sustainable practices and the development of eco-friendly products, including bio-pesticides and precision application systems. Latin America is another significant market, with countries like Brazil and Argentina being major agricultural exporters. The region's growth is fueled by large-scale farming of commodity crops such as soybeans and corn, which require substantial agrochemical inputs. The Middle East and Africa region, while currently a smaller market, presents potential for growth due to efforts to improve agricultural output and achieve food self-sufficiency. However, challenges such as water scarcity and less developed infrastructure can impact agrochemical adoption. Across all regions, local regulations regarding pesticide registration, environmental protection, and maximum residue limits greatly influence market dynamics and product strategies of agrochemical companies.
The competitive landscape of the agrochemical market is dominated by a handful of global giants that have established themselves through extensive research, broad product portfolios, and strong international presence. Bayer AG, following its acquisition of Monsanto, has solidified its position as a market leader, offering a comprehensive range of seeds, traits, and crop protection products, including herbicides like glyphosate. Syngenta Group, now part of the China National Chemical Corporation (ChemChina), is another powerhouse, renowned for its innovation in seeds and crop protection solutions, with a significant focus on sustainable agriculture. BASF SE maintains a strong standing through its diversified chemical expertise, producing a wide array of fungicides, insecticides, and herbicides, and is actively investing in digital farming tools. Corteva Agriscience, spun off from DowDuPont, leverages its heritage to provide advanced seed genetics and crop protection products, emphasizing integrated solutions for farmers. FMC Corporation is a key player known for its insecticide portfolio and recent growth through acquisitions, enhancing its capabilities in biologicals and specialty products. Beyond these leaders, companies like UPL Limited, Sumitomo Chemical, and Nufarm Limited hold substantial market shares, often with strengths in specific regions or product categories. These companies compete intensely on innovation, pricing, and sustainability, with strategic focuses on developing products that address resistance issues and meet evolving regulatory and environmental standards.

What are the different types of agrochemicals?
Agrochemicals are broadly categorized into fertilizers, pesticides, and plant growth regulators. Fertilizers provide essential nutrients to plants and are subdivided into nitrogenous, phosphatic, and potassic types. Pesticides include insecticides for insect control, herbicides for weed management, fungicides to prevent fungal diseases, and other specific categories like nematicides and rodenticides. Plant growth regulators are chemicals used to alter the growth of plants.
